Enhance Your Luxury Bathroom with Soft Dimming Vanity Lighting

Soft dimming vanity lighting can significantly influence the aesthetic and functional performance of a luxury bathroom. This article explores the various aspects of integrating such lighting, from technical specifications to design considerations, aiming to provide a comprehensive understanding for individuals considering this enhancement.

Soft dimming refers to a lighting technology that allows for a gradual and smooth reduction in light intensity, often to very low levels, without flickering or color shift. This contrasts with traditional dimming, which can sometimes produce abrupt changes or introduce unwelcome visual artifacts. In the context of vanity lighting, soft dimming provides a nuanced control over the light environment.

Technical Aspects of Soft Dimming

The smooth transition offered by soft dimming is primarily achieved through advanced dimmer technologies and compatible light sources.

Dimmer Compatibility

Modern dimmers often employ pulse-width modulation (PWM) or phase-cut dimming (leading edge or trailing edge). LED light sources require specific dimmer types for optimal performance. Using an incompatible dimmer can lead to flickering, buzzing, reduced lifespan of the LED, or an inability to dim to desired levels. For luxury bathrooms, constant-current dimmable LED drivers are frequently preferred for their stability and wide dimming range.

Light Source Selection

While incandescent bulbs dim linearly, their energy inefficiency makes them less suitable for contemporary applications. LED technology, though more complex to dim smoothly, offers superior energy efficiency and longevity. When selecting LED bulbs or fixtures, look for “dimmable” specifications and consider their dimming range, often expressed as a percentage (e.g., dims down to 1%). Some LEDs are specifically designed for “warm dimming,” where the color temperature shifts to a warmer hue as the light dims, mimicking incandescent behavior, which can be desirable in a luxury setting.

Control Systems

Beyond wall-mounted dimmers, integrated smart home systems can provide advanced control over soft dimming vanity lighting. These systems offer programmable scenes, remote access, and integration with other bathroom functionalities, allowing for customized lighting experiences.

Architectural and Design Integration

The seamless integration of soft dimming vanity lighting within the bathroom’s overall design is crucial for achieving a cohesive luxury aesthetic. This involves considering fixture placement, material choices, and how the lighting complements other design elements.

Fixture Placement and Orientation

The primary function of vanity lighting is to illuminate the face evenly without creating harsh shadows. Soft dimming capability further refines this.

Lateral Sconces or Pendants

Placing symmetrical sconces or pendants at eye level on either side of the mirror is generally recommended for optimal facial illumination. This horizontal distribution minimizes shadows under the chin and eyes. With soft dimming, these fixtures can be adjusted from a bright, functional light for grooming to a subtle glow for relaxation.

Overhead Lighting

While overhead can lights can provide general ambient illumination, relying solely on them for vanity lighting can create harsh shadows by shining down from above. If used in conjunction with side lighting, they should be dimmable and positioned to fill in gaps rather than dominate the lighting scheme. The soft dimming feature allows for the overhead light to be dialed back when intimate task lighting is preferred.

Integrated Mirror Lighting

Many luxury mirrors now feature integrated LED lighting, often with dimming capabilities. These can be perimeter lights (backlit or front-lit) or lights embedded directly into the mirror surface. When integrated, the soft dimming allows for a clean, minimalist aesthetic while maintaining functional flexibility.

Material and Finish Selection

The materials and finishes of the lighting fixtures should harmonize with the bathroom’s aesthetic. Metals such as brushed nickel, polished chrome, or matte black are common. Glass shades in frosted or etched finishes can diffuse light, contributing to a softer illumination. Dimming capability enhances the perceived quality of these materials by allowing their textures and reflections to be viewed under varied light intensities.

Functional Benefits in a Luxury Context

Beyond aesthetics, soft dimming vanity lighting offers several practical advantages that align with the expectations of a luxury bathroom. These benefits contribute to comfort, versatility, and energy efficiency.

Enhanced User Comfort and Well-being

The ability to adjust light levels directly impacts user comfort. Harsh, bright light can be jarring, especially early in the morning or late at night.

Circadian Rhythm Support

By adjusting light intensity and potentially color temperature, soft dimming can support the body’s natural circadian rhythm. Brighter, cooler light in the morning can aid alertness, while warmer, dimmer light in the evening can promote relaxation and prepare the body for sleep. This subtle yet significant feature transcends basic illumination, becoming a catalyst for well-being.

Glare Reduction

Dimming the lights directly reduces glare, making grooming tasks more comfortable. Excessive brightness can cause eye strain and make it difficult to see accurately. Soft dimming provides the user with control, like adjusting the volume on a complex piece of audio equipment, to find the perfect level of visual input.

Versatility for Diverse Activities

A luxury bathroom is often a multi-functional space, accommodating various activities from detailed grooming to leisurely soaking.

Task Illumination

For precision tasks such as shaving, applying makeup, or styling hair, bright, even, and consistent light is essential. Soft dimming allows the user to quickly achieve this optimal level of brightness without compromise.

Mood Lighting

When the primary function transitions from task-oriented to relaxation, such as during a bath, the lighting can be subtly dimmed to create a serene and tranquil atmosphere. The light becomes a paintbrush, allowing the user to create the desired ambiance on the canvas of their surroundings. This adaptability transforms the bathroom from a purely functional room into a sanctuary.

Energy Efficiency and Longevity

While luxury often emphasizes quality and experience, energy efficiency remains an important consideration. Soft dimming, particularly with LED technology, contributes to both.

Reduced Energy Consumption

Dimming an LED light source reduces its power consumption proportionally. While a fully dimmed LED still draws some power, significant energy savings are realized over time, especially when compared to traditional lighting that is either on or off at full power. This aligns with environmentally conscious design principles without compromising performance.

Extended Lifespan of Light Sources

Operating LEDs at lower light levels (i.e., dimmed) reduces the stress on their internal components, leading to a longer operational lifespan. This translates to fewer bulb replacements, reducing maintenance requirements and costs over the long term, which is a desirable characteristic in a high-end application.

Installation and Maintenance Considerations

Implementing soft dimming vanity lighting effectively requires attention to installation details and ongoing maintenance practices to ensure optimal performance and longevity.

Professional Installation

Given the specific wiring requirements, compatibility nuances between dimmers and LED drivers, and the integration with potential smart home systems, professional installation is strongly advised. An experienced electrician can ensure proper wiring, correct dimmer selection, and adherence to local building codes, preventing potential issues such as flickering, buzzing, or premature component failure.

Wiring Requirements

Modern dimming systems, especially those for low-voltage LED fixtures, may require specific wiring configurations (e.g., neutral wire for some smart dimmers, or dedicated dimming control wires for certain LED drivers). These details are critical for reliable operation.

System Calibration

After installation, some advanced dimming systems may require calibration to achieve their full dimming range and smooth transitions. This ensures that the lowest dimming level is truly “off” if desired, and that there are no abrupt jumps in brightness.

Ongoing Maintenance

While LEDs are known for their longevity, periodic checks can help maintain performance.

Cleaning Fixtures

Dust and residue can accumulate on light fixtures and diffusers, reducing light output and potentially affecting soft dimming performance. Regular, gentle cleaning, using appropriate cleaning agents for the fixture’s materials, helps preserve both aesthetics and functionality.

Driver and Component Checks

In the rare event of flickering or erratic dimming behavior, a qualified technician may need to inspect the LED driver or dimmer module. These components, while robust, are the primary points of failure in an otherwise long-lasting LED system. Addressing issues promptly can prevent escalating problems.

Future Trends in Luxury Bathroom Lighting

The evolution of lighting technology continues to offer new possibilities for luxury bathrooms. Future trends are likely to further enhance the capabilities of soft dimming vanity lighting.

Advanced Warm Dimming

While current warm dimming LEDs shift color temperature as they dim, future iterations may offer broader and more precise control over the chromaticity, allowing for an even wider spectrum of atmospheric options. This includes the ability to mimic specific light sources, such as candlelight, with greater accuracy.

Human-Centric Lighting Integration

Human-centric lighting (HCL) aims to synchronize lighting with human biological needs. In a luxury bathroom, this could mean highly personalized lighting schedules that automatically adjust intensity and color temperature throughout the day based on the user’s preferences, wake-up times, and even seasonal changes. Soft dimming is a fundamental component of HCL, enabling the smooth transitions required for such systems.

Seamless Integration with Smart Surfaces

As smart surfaces become more prevalent, future vanity lighting might be seamlessly integrated into mirrors, countertops, or wall panels, becoming virtually invisible when off. Soft dimming controls would then be integrated directly into these surfaces, potentially activated by touch or gesture, further enhancing the minimalist aesthetic and user experience.

Enhanced Tunable White Capabilities

Tunable white lighting allows for adjustment of color temperature from warm to cool, independent of brightness. When combined with soft dimming, this creates an unparalleled level of control, allowing users to precisely set both the intensity and the “feel” of the light. This level of customization allows the light itself to adapt to individual moods and tasks, transcending basic illumination to become an integral element of personalized comfort and well-being.
